Output 7f302ef19a81b903a2639d96f24668d4d32baddfa29755c1dba80c0904c8c3b6:1

value
628719
script pubkey
OP_0 OP_PUSHBYTES_20 de2871ca4fd29d4ab479e521f5006f84e3f0681a
address
bc1qmc58rjj062w54dreu5sl2qr0sn3lq6q69fktz6
transaction
7f302ef19a81b903a2639d96f24668d4d32baddfa29755c1dba80c0904c8c3b6
spent
true